Figure 1. Schematic representation of the physiological activation of NOTCH in our working model of paracrine activation of IL-6. A: JAG2 binds NOTCH via cell-to-cell contact. B: Binding of JAG2 induces a proteolytic cleavage of the intracellular part of NOTCH (NIC). C: When cleaved, NIC is translocated into the nucleus. D: Once in the nucleus, NIC will be able to bind to downstream effectors such as CBF1 to activate, for example, the IL-6 gene transcription.
